I know that is a pretty lame title. But I have never been the best with creative naming. While exploring San Jose while my kids were in school I stumbled across the Heritage Rose Garden. Which as they describe it 

…delighting you with a world class collection of almost 4,000 plants of more than 3,000 varieties of heritage, modern and miniature roses, initially planted by more than 750 volunteers in March, 1995. 

It is certainly a beautiful sight. I am not a big rose buff but there were only a couple of roses that I had ever heard of. The first time I went I did not take my camera. So then I decided to go back and this time I went prepared. Here are a few of my favorite images from the visit.
